Demographics

Glen Park has a population of 624 with a median age of 28.9. Here is the racial and ethnic breakdown of the population:

Income & Economy

The median household income in Glen Park is $43,125, which is 46.5% below the national median of $80,610. The per capita income is $23,212. The poverty rate is 41.3%.

Education

In Glen Park, 91.7% of residents age 25+ have a high school diploma or higher, and 22.5% hold a bachelor's degree or higher (3.9% with a graduate or professional degree).

Housing

The median home value in Glen Park is $177,100, below the national median of $303,400. The median monthly rent is $1,096. The homeownership rate is 76.3%.
